The team you will be working with:

As a Lead Service Designer, you will bring 8+ years of experience designing human-centred services that balance business value, technical feasibility, and user desirability. You will work in agile, cross-functional teams across public and private sectors, helping clients make confident, design-led decisions through a consultative, evidence-based approach. Applicants must be SC clearable and able to share a strong design portfolio.

What you will be doing:

  • Lead end-to-end design projects – Oversee multidisciplinary work across public and private sectors, collaborating with design professionals through all phases, from research and ideation to delivery and continuous improvement.
  • Shape strategy through design – Apply a systemic, design-led lens to complex challenges, turning insights and requirements into clear visual maps that break silos, reveal opportunities, and guide impactful action across ecosystems.
  • Support growth and business development – Contribute to pitches and proposals, proactively identifying new opportunities and helping position design as a strategic lever for clients.
  • Champion and grow service design at NTT DATA UK – Advocate for the role of service and strategic design with clients and colleagues, build confidence in its value, and help grow our practice as part of Tangity's global design community.
  • Design for the age of AI – Work with business consulting and technology experts to explore how design can shape a responsible, human-centred adoption of AI and agentic systems.
  • Measure and communicate impact – Combine qualitative insight and quantitative data to show the impact of design, inform decisions, and drive ongoing improvement.

What experience you will bring:

  • 8+ years' experience leading end-to-end service or strategic design projects across complex organisations.
  • Depth in service design methods, including user research, systems thinking, and workshop facilitation.
  • A track record of engaging and aligning senior leaders and multidisciplinary teams around shared outcomes, with examples of guiding decision-making through clear evidence and structured collaboration.
  • Confidence using data and evidence to inform design decisions, define success metrics, and demonstrate business value.
  • Clear and compelling communication and storytelling skills.
  • Experience mentoring and supporting designers, helping them grow their craft and confidence.
  • Consultative and proactive mindset, comfortable navigating ambiguity in fast-changing environments, ideally within consultancy or large-scale transformation settings.
  • Active or eligible SC clearance (British citizen or equivalent, with at least 5 years of UK residency).

Nice to Have:

  • Degree in Service Design, UX, HCI, Psychology, or a related discipline.
  • Business development and sales experience.
  • Knowledge of change management or behavioural design.
  • Familiarity with business modelling and business case development.
  • Interest in exploring and experimenting with AI and automation.
  • Experience working with or alongside the UK public sector or to GDS (Government Digital Service) standards.
  • Entrepreneurial experience, whether from founding or working in a startup, or leading your own side project or initiative.

About NTT DATA and Tangity:

NTT DATA is a trusted global innovator with over 100,000 professionals in 50+ countries. Headquartered in Tokyo, we bring elements of our Japanese heritage—precision, long-term thinking, and social responsibility—into our UK work. In the UK, we work across telecoms, financial services, manufacturing, and the public sector, delivering end-to-end services from strategy to implementation.

Tangity - Part of the NTT DATA, is a global design studio dedicated to humanising complexity. We combine Strategy, Technology, and Design to create meaningful, inclusive, and impactful services that improve lives and systems. Our studios work closely with delivery teams to embed design deeply into every project and across every touchpoint.
